Lafarge Cement
Lafarge Cement is an industrial building in Brooklyn, New York. Lafarge Cement is situated nearby to the power station Joseph J. Seymour Power Project, as well as near Gowanus Gas Turbines Generating.Places of Interest Nearby

The Metropolitan Detention Center, Brooklyn is a United States federal administrative detention facility in the Sunset Park neighborhood of Brooklyn, New York City, New York, United States. Metropolitan Detention Center, Brooklyn is situated 1,300 feet south of Lafarge Cement.

The 25th Street station is a local station on the BMT Fourth Avenue Line of the New York City Subway. Located at the intersection of 25th Street and Fourth Avenue in Greenwood Heights, Brooklyn, it is served by the R train at all times. 25th Street station is situated 1,500 feet southeast of Lafarge Cement.

The 25th Street station was a station on the now demolished BMT Fifth Avenue Line in Brooklyn, New York City. It was served by trains of the BMT Culver Line and BMT Fifth Avenue Line. 25th Street station is situated 2,300 feet southeast of Lafarge Cement.

Red Hook is a neighborhood in western Brooklyn, New York City, United States, within the area once known as South Brooklyn. It is located on a peninsula projecting into the Upper New York Bay and is bounded by the Gowanus Expressway and the Carroll Gardens neighborhood on the northeast, Gowanus Canal on the east, and the Upper New York Bay on the west and south.
